Broadwater, Nebraska has an median home value of $74,900 which is lower than the U.S. median home value of $338,100. However, homes in Broadwater have seen higher appreciation in the last year at 10.45%, compared to 8.27% for the United States overall. Overall, housing in Broadwater is affordable and appreciating quickly - making it a great place for those looking to invest or purchase a home.

The median home cost in Broadwater is $74,900.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 80.6%. Home Appreciation in Broadwater is up 15.2%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Broadwater real estate is 78 years old
The Rental Market in Broadwater
- Renters make up 13.9% of the Broadwater population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in Broadwater, are available to rent
